[Clinical and morphological features of ameloblastomas]
Summary
Histological features of ameloblastomas, including proliferative activity and MMP-9 expression, were identified. These features correlate with clinical behavior and can predict ameloblastoma recurrence probability.
Area of Science:
- Oral pathology
- Oncology
- Biomarkers
Background:
- Ameloblastomas are odontogenic tumors with a high recurrence rate.
- Predicting recurrence is crucial for patient management and treatment planning.
Purpose of the Study:
- To identify histological and immunohistochemical markers for ameloblastoma recurrence.
- To correlate tumor characteristics with clinical behavior.
Main Methods:
- Clinical, histological, and immunohistochemical analyses of ameloblastomas.
- Assessment of proliferative activity and matrix metalloproteinase-9 (MMP-9) expression.
Main Results:
- Specific tumor varieties were identified based on proliferative activity and MMP-9 expression.
- Histological features were found to be associated with the clinical course of ameloblastomas.
Conclusions:
- Histological features, including proliferative activity and MMP-9 expression, can serve as predictive markers for ameloblastoma recurrence.
- These markers may aid in stratifying patients based on recurrence risk.
